The Skilhunt DS20 legoes with the (shorty) battery tube of the BLF-A6. The o-rings do not engage at all so the combination is not waterproof, but it works fine on a 18350.

Fire Flies E01 and E 07 are the same except for the head. All parts interchange, same tube same tailcap.

V10r Ti w AA extender from V11r



The Nitecore P12 tailcap fits perfectly onto the Nitecore P30. It makes it easier to use a lanyard without having to use the tactical ring on the P30, and it will tail stand. Tail standing is not perfect because the rubber boot on the P12 switch is a bit taller then the cap. However, It does work as you can see in the pic.

Anyone know what other lights have threads that Astrolux S41/S42/S43 (Mateminco S01/S02/S03) tubes would lego with?

Trying to find more attractive 18650 and 18350 tubes for a new Astrolux S43S that is on it's way. (Copper head, alu body version).
Both the S41S and S42S have editions with lovely Stainless/Coloured tubes, tails and bezels. But they never made these complete editions of the S43.

I have already ordered the official 18650 tubes in SS from Banggood which are available separately at reasonable price.

They also have matching tails in SS available separately - but only the S41 version with button.

The S42/43 flat buttonless style doesn't seem to be available separately. Neither do the shorter SS/Coloured 18350 tubes seem to be individually available.

I've contacted Mateminco (OEM) to see if they can supply these body parts separately. Besides, their stock S03 tube (Black Alu) is much nicer than the completely smooth plain tube they supplied for the Astrolux S43. The Mateminco version has rather cool finger indents!

I'm sorted with the Stainless tubes now on an Astrolux S43S - but still can't obtain a matching bezel.

Result is that it will lego with the currently available (from my own experience) BLF A6/X6 and Astrolux S1/X6 tubes. (NOT Convoy S2+ tubes.)
